Transaction c57763c7aeeca30566110af23441ca6182b2739a52a504e6d4ce324c49147e05

1 Input
2 Outputs
  • c57763c7aeeca30566110af23441ca6182b2739a52a504e6d4ce324c49147e05:0
  • value  1017718
    address  38zDPGviUGREAtmqVDt65GRsitDy3GP7FW
  • c57763c7aeeca30566110af23441ca6182b2739a52a504e6d4ce324c49147e05:1
  • value  10917362
    address  32xRMhR32K22KZXxdkg5PZzjvimaMAoTWx